The passenger car and the freight car are facing each other from a and B at the same time. They meet 95 kilometers away from B. after meeting, the two cars continue to move forward
After arriving at a and B, the two vehicles immediately return at the same speed, and then meet 25 kilometers away from A. how many kilometers are there between a and B?


Let the distance between a and B be x, and the speed of bus and train be a and B respectively
According to the principle of equal time, when two cars meet twice, the time they spend should be equal,
Then, when we first met, the equation was:
95/b=(x-95)/a
The equation of the second meeting is as follows:
(x+25)/b=(2s-25)/a
The two equations are simplified
(x-95)*(x+25)=95*(2x-25)
Rearrangement:
x*(x-260)=0
Solution
x=260
So the distance between a and B is 260 kilometers
